Every candidate has their own prime top level domain name for their campaign. But how do they get these domains even if they are their name and how much do they pay? Currently, Mike Huckabee’s website(www.mikehuckabee.com) is pulling in donations of roughly $5000 every 15 minutes. Not bad. Apparently, the only person who had a say in whether Mike Huckabee’s website was MikeHuckabee.com, was the former domain owner and webmaster of Mike Huckabee. Man, did this old webmaster dislike Mike Huckabee! The question im posing is; Why did this anti-Huckabee person sell the domain to Huckabee and how much did he sell it for even if he knew Huckabee was hinting on running for President? Take a look.
Heres a picture of his website on Nov. 26, 2002….MikeHuckabee.com…

Now notice how the layout has changed a bit. This is from Nov. 2004, 2 years later.

Here’s MikeHuckabee.com on Sept. 2006, notice the top phrase. If I’m correct, Huckabee announced his plans to run for President about a year ago. Weird.

And Finally, the “For Sale” notice, I wonder how much Mike Huckabee paid for this domain?
